Searched refs:bus_space_handle_t (Results 1 - 25 of 396) sorted by relevance

1234567891011>>

/freebsd-12-stable/sys/riscv/include/
H A D_bus.h43 typedef u_long bus_space_handle_t; typedef
/freebsd-12-stable/sys/sparc64/include/
H A D_bus.h38 typedef u_long bus_space_handle_t; typedef
H A Dbus.h115 static void bus_space_barrier(bus_space_tag_t, bus_space_handle_t, bus_size_t,
117 static int bus_space_subregion(bus_space_tag_t, bus_space_handle_t,
118 bus_size_t, bus_size_t, bus_space_handle_t *);
124 int flags, bus_space_handle_t *handlep);
129 void bus_space_unmap(bus_space_tag_t tag, bus_space_handle_t handle,
133 bus_space_barrier(bus_space_tag_t t __unused, bus_space_handle_t h __unused,
147 bus_space_subregion(bus_space_tag_t t __unused, bus_space_handle_t h,
148 bus_size_t o __unused, bus_size_t s __unused, bus_space_handle_t *hp)
181 bus_space_read_1(bus_space_tag_t t, bus_space_handle_t h, bus_size_t o)
189 bus_space_read_2(bus_space_tag_t t, bus_space_handle_t
[all...]
H A Dbus_private.h42 int flags, vm_offset_t vaddr, bus_space_handle_t *hp);
43 int sparc64_bus_mem_unmap(bus_space_tag_t tag, bus_space_handle_t handle,
46 bus_space_handle_t sparc64_fake_bustag(int space, bus_addr_t addr,
/freebsd-12-stable/sys/arm/include/
H A D_bus.h45 typedef u_long bus_space_handle_t; typedef
H A Dbus.h75 * bus_size_t size, int flags, bus_space_handle_t *bshp);
93 uint8_t (*bs_r_1)(bus_space_tag_t, bus_space_handle_t, bus_size_t);
94 uint32_t (*bs_r_4)(bus_space_tag_t, bus_space_handle_t, bus_size_t);
95 void (*bs_w_1)(bus_space_tag_t, bus_space_handle_t,
97 void (*bs_w_4)(bus_space_tag_t, bus_space_handle_t,
99 void (*bs_barrier)(bus_space_tag_t, bus_space_handle_t,
108 int, bus_space_handle_t *);
109 void (*bs_unmap) (bus_space_tag_t, bus_space_handle_t, bus_size_t);
110 int (*bs_subregion) (bus_space_tag_t, bus_space_handle_t,
111 bus_size_t, bus_size_t, bus_space_handle_t *);
[all...]
/freebsd-12-stable/sys/arm64/include/
H A D_bus.h43 typedef u_long bus_space_handle_t; typedef
/freebsd-12-stable/sys/amd64/include/
H A D_bus.h46 typedef uint64_t bus_space_handle_t; typedef
/freebsd-12-stable/sys/riscv/riscv/
H A Dbus_machdep.c46 uint8_t generic_bs_r_1(void *, bus_space_handle_t, bus_size_t);
47 uint16_t generic_bs_r_2(void *, bus_space_handle_t, bus_size_t);
48 uint32_t generic_bs_r_4(void *, bus_space_handle_t, bus_size_t);
49 uint64_t generic_bs_r_8(void *, bus_space_handle_t, bus_size_t);
51 void generic_bs_rm_1(void *, bus_space_handle_t, bus_size_t, uint8_t *,
53 void generic_bs_rm_2(void *, bus_space_handle_t, bus_size_t, uint16_t *,
55 void generic_bs_rm_4(void *, bus_space_handle_t, bus_size_t, uint32_t *,
57 void generic_bs_rm_8(void *, bus_space_handle_t, bus_size_t, uint64_t *,
60 void generic_bs_rr_1(void *, bus_space_handle_t, bus_size_t, uint8_t *,
62 void generic_bs_rr_2(void *, bus_space_handle_t, bus_size_
[all...]
/freebsd-12-stable/sys/powerpc/include/
H A D_bus.h48 typedef vm_offset_t bus_space_handle_t; typedef
H A Dbus.h107 bus_space_handle_t *);
109 int (*bs_subregion)(bus_space_handle_t, bus_size_t,
110 bus_size_t, bus_space_handle_t *);
114 bus_size_t, bus_size_t, int, bus_addr_t *, bus_space_handle_t *);
115 void (*bs_free)(bus_space_handle_t, bus_size_t);
117 void (*bs_barrier)(bus_space_handle_t, bus_size_t,
121 uint8_t (*bs_r_1)(bus_space_handle_t, bus_size_t);
122 uint16_t (*bs_r_2)(bus_space_handle_t, bus_size_t);
123 uint32_t (*bs_r_4)(bus_space_handle_t, bus_size_t);
124 uint64_t (*bs_r_8)(bus_space_handle_t, bus_size_
[all...]
/freebsd-12-stable/sys/mips/include/
H A D_bus.h51 typedef bus_addr_t bus_space_handle_t; typedef
H A Dbus.h79 int, bus_space_handle_t *);
80 void (*bs_unmap) (void *, bus_space_handle_t, bus_size_t);
81 int (*bs_subregion) (void *, bus_space_handle_t,
82 bus_size_t, bus_size_t, bus_space_handle_t *);
87 bus_addr_t *, bus_space_handle_t *);
88 void (*bs_free) (void *, bus_space_handle_t,
93 void (*bs_barrier) (void *, bus_space_handle_t,
97 u_int8_t (*bs_r_1) (void *, bus_space_handle_t, bus_size_t);
98 u_int16_t (*bs_r_2) (void *, bus_space_handle_t, bus_size_t);
99 u_int32_t (*bs_r_4) (void *, bus_space_handle_t, bus_size_
[all...]
/freebsd-12-stable/sys/i386/include/
H A D_bus.h50 typedef u_int bus_space_handle_t; typedef
/freebsd-12-stable/sys/arm64/arm64/
H A Dbus_machdep.c38 uint8_t generic_bs_r_1(void *, bus_space_handle_t, bus_size_t);
39 uint16_t generic_bs_r_2(void *, bus_space_handle_t, bus_size_t);
40 uint32_t generic_bs_r_4(void *, bus_space_handle_t, bus_size_t);
41 uint64_t generic_bs_r_8(void *, bus_space_handle_t, bus_size_t);
43 void generic_bs_rm_1(void *, bus_space_handle_t, bus_size_t, uint8_t *,
45 void generic_bs_rm_2(void *, bus_space_handle_t, bus_size_t, uint16_t *,
47 void generic_bs_rm_4(void *, bus_space_handle_t, bus_size_t, uint32_t *,
49 void generic_bs_rm_8(void *, bus_space_handle_t, bus_size_t, uint64_t *,
52 void generic_bs_rr_1(void *, bus_space_handle_t, bus_size_t, uint8_t *,
54 void generic_bs_rr_2(void *, bus_space_handle_t, bus_size_
[all...]
/freebsd-12-stable/sys/mips/nlm/
H A Dbus_space_rmi.c54 bus_space_handle_t *bshp);
57 rmi_bus_space_unmap(void *t, bus_space_handle_t bsh,
62 bus_space_handle_t bsh,
64 bus_space_handle_t *nbshp);
68 bus_space_handle_t handle,
73 bus_space_handle_t handle,
78 bus_space_handle_t handle,
83 bus_space_handle_t handle,
89 bus_space_handle_t handle,
95 bus_space_handle_t handl
[all...]
H A Dbus_space_rmi_pci.c54 bus_space_handle_t * bshp);
57 rmi_pci_bus_space_unmap(void *t, bus_space_handle_t bsh,
62 bus_space_handle_t bsh,
64 bus_space_handle_t * nbshp);
68 bus_space_handle_t handle,
73 bus_space_handle_t handle,
78 bus_space_handle_t handle,
83 bus_space_handle_t handle,
89 bus_space_handle_t handle,
95 bus_space_handle_t handl
[all...]
/freebsd-12-stable/stand/kshim/
H A Dbsd_busspace.c41 bus_space_subregion(bus_space_tag_t t, bus_space_handle_t bsh,
42 bus_size_t offset, bus_size_t size, bus_space_handle_t *nbshp)
50 bus_space_read_multi_1(bus_space_tag_t t, bus_space_handle_t h,
59 bus_space_read_multi_2(bus_space_tag_t t, bus_space_handle_t h,
68 bus_space_read_multi_4(bus_space_tag_t t, bus_space_handle_t h,
79 bus_space_write_multi_1(bus_space_tag_t t, bus_space_handle_t h,
90 bus_space_write_multi_2(bus_space_tag_t t, bus_space_handle_t h,
101 bus_space_write_multi_4(bus_space_tag_t t, bus_space_handle_t h,
112 bus_space_write_1(bus_space_tag_t t, bus_space_handle_t h,
119 bus_space_write_2(bus_space_tag_t t, bus_space_handle_t
[all...]
/freebsd-12-stable/sys/arm/arm/
H A Dbus_space_generic.c70 bus_space_handle_t *bshp)
81 *bshp = (bus_space_handle_t)va;
88 bus_space_handle_t *bshp)
96 generic_bs_unmap(bus_space_tag_t t, bus_space_handle_t h, bus_size_t size)
103 generic_bs_free(bus_space_tag_t t, bus_space_handle_t bsh, bus_size_t size)
110 generic_bs_subregion(bus_space_tag_t t, bus_space_handle_t bsh, bus_size_t offset,
111 bus_size_t size, bus_space_handle_t *nbshp)
119 generic_bs_barrier(bus_space_tag_t t, bus_space_handle_t bsh, bus_size_t offset,
/freebsd-12-stable/sys/arm64/cavium/
H A Dthunder_pcie_pem.h41 bus_space_handle_t reg_bsh;
46 bus_space_handle_t pem_sli_base;
/freebsd-12-stable/sys/x86/include/
H A Dbus.h139 int flags, bus_space_handle_t *bshp);
145 void bus_space_unmap(bus_space_tag_t tag, bus_space_handle_t bsh,
153 bus_space_handle_t bsh,
155 bus_space_handle_t *nbshp);
158 bus_space_subregion(bus_space_tag_t t __unused, bus_space_handle_t bsh,
160 bus_space_handle_t *nbshp)
174 bus_space_handle_t *bshp);
180 static __inline void bus_space_free(bus_space_tag_t t, bus_space_handle_t bsh,
184 bus_space_free(bus_space_tag_t t __unused, bus_space_handle_t bsh __unused,
195 bus_space_handle_t handl
[all...]
/freebsd-12-stable/sys/mips/cavium/
H A Doctopci_bus_space.c212 bus_space_handle_t *bshp)
220 octopci_bs_unmap(void *t __unused, bus_space_handle_t bh __unused,
228 octopci_bs_subregion(void *t __unused, bus_space_handle_t handle,
230 bus_space_handle_t *bshp)
238 octopci_bs_r_1(void *t, bus_space_handle_t handle,
246 octopci_bs_r_2(void *t, bus_space_handle_t handle,
254 octopci_bs_r_4(void *t, bus_space_handle_t handle,
263 octopci_bs_rm_1(void *t, bus_space_handle_t bsh,
272 octopci_bs_rm_2(void *t, bus_space_handle_t bsh,
282 octopci_bs_rm_4(void *t, bus_space_handle_t bs
[all...]
H A Duart_cpu_octeonusart.c60 ou_bs_r_1(void *t, bus_space_handle_t handle, bus_size_t offset)
67 ou_bs_r_2(void *t, bus_space_handle_t handle, bus_size_t offset)
74 ou_bs_r_4(void *t, bus_space_handle_t handle, bus_size_t offset)
81 ou_bs_r_8(void *t, bus_space_handle_t handle, bus_size_t offset)
88 ou_bs_w_1(void *t, bus_space_handle_t bsh, bus_size_t offset, uint8_t value)
95 ou_bs_w_2(void *t, bus_space_handle_t bsh, bus_size_t offset, uint16_t value)
102 ou_bs_w_4(void *t, bus_space_handle_t bsh, bus_size_t offset, uint32_t value)
109 ou_bs_w_8(void *t, bus_space_handle_t bsh, bus_size_t offset, uint64_t value)
/freebsd-12-stable/sys/mips/mips/
H A Dbus_space_generic.c234 bus_space_handle_t *bshp)
237 *bshp = (bus_space_handle_t)pmap_mapdev((vm_paddr_t)addr,
243 generic_bs_unmap(void *t __unused, bus_space_handle_t bh,
251 generic_bs_subregion(void *t __unused, bus_space_handle_t handle,
253 bus_space_handle_t *bshp)
263 bus_addr_t *bpap, bus_space_handle_t *bshp)
270 generic_bs_free(void *t, bus_space_handle_t bsh, bus_size_t size)
277 generic_bs_r_1(void *t, bus_space_handle_t handle,
285 generic_bs_r_2(void *t, bus_space_handle_t handle,
293 generic_bs_r_4(void *t, bus_space_handle_t handl
[all...]
/freebsd-12-stable/sys/powerpc/powerpc/
H A Dbus_machdep.c67 __ppc_ba(bus_space_handle_t bsh, bus_size_t ofs)
74 bus_space_handle_t *bshp)
102 *bshp = (bus_space_handle_t)pmap_mapdev_attr(addr, size, ma);
150 bs_gen_subregion(bus_space_handle_t bsh, bus_size_t ofs,
151 bus_size_t size __unused, bus_space_handle_t *nbshp)
161 bus_addr_t *bpap __unused, bus_space_handle_t *bshp __unused)
167 bs_gen_free(bus_space_handle_t bsh __unused, bus_size_t size __unused)
173 bs_gen_barrier(bus_space_handle_t bsh __unused, bus_size_t ofs __unused,
184 bs_be_rs_1(bus_space_handle_t bsh, bus_size_t ofs)
197 bs_be_rs_2(bus_space_handle_t bs
[all...]

Completed in 143 milliseconds

1234567891011>>